thanks, files raw from iPod are pretty big. I use another app to convert the wavs to mp3, then edit, export, upload to server and post. Screen shot below shows the 3 files for 4 races (I let it run for G1 & G2 hence the huge file).
iPod not the right device for this, doesn't have enough battery life. At track have to get a couple races, then throw on car charger for a while, then get more races (doing this and racing is maddening). There are many digital recorders that will do this, need one with either longer batt. life or one that will work on 115 vac while recording (can't with iPod). Will let ya know what I find out. Need to just set up recorder in race control before race one and let it record all day, noting start times of each race would make finding them easy.
The 2nd pic is the Micromemo adapter used with the iPod, just get a male/male miniplug cable and connect scanner headphone out to Micromeno input (the cool gooseneck mic stays in the bag). Works great aside from the power problem.
